iOS内核优化赋能评论模块提效
|
在iOS应用开发中,评论模块作为用户互动的核心功能,其性能表现直接影响用户体验。随着内容量的持续增长,传统实现方式逐渐暴露出响应延迟、卡顿频繁等问题。为解决这一痛点,我们对iOS内核底层机制进行了深度优化,显著提升了评论模块的运行效率。
2026AI模拟图,仅供参考 优化的核心在于减少主线程负担。过去,评论数据的解析与渲染常在主线程同步执行,导致界面卡顿。通过引入异步处理机制,我们将数据解析、图片加载等耗时操作迁移至后台线程,并利用GCD(Grand Central Dispatch)进行任务调度,有效避免了主线程阻塞。 同时,针对评论列表的滚动性能,我们重构了Cell复用逻辑。采用更精细的缓存策略,结合弱引用管理,降低内存占用。对于动态高度的评论项,通过预计算布局尺寸,减少了频繁的layoutIntrinsicContentSize调用,使滑动更加流畅。 在数据结构层面,我们优化了评论模型的存储方式。将原本嵌套过深的JSON结构扁平化处理,配合Core Data与SQLite的协同使用,提升读写速度。配合增量更新机制,仅刷新变化部分,大幅减少全量重绘开销。 借助iOS系统提供的懒加载与预加载能力,评论模块在用户滑动时提前加载下一屏内容,实现“无缝衔接”。结合网络请求的合并与去重策略,避免重复请求,节省带宽并加快响应速度。 经过一系列内核级优化,评论模块的平均响应时间下降60%,内存峰值降低45%,用户反馈的卡顿率几乎归零。更重要的是,这些改进具备良好的可维护性,为后续功能扩展提供了坚实基础。 技术的演进不止于功能堆叠,更在于对底层机制的深刻理解与精准打磨。通过内核优化赋能,评论模块不仅跑得更快,也更稳、更智能,真正实现了从“可用”到“好用”的跨越。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

